位置: IT常识 - 正文

微信小程序最新获取头像和昵称的方法 直接用!(微信小程序最新咸鱼之王兑换)

编辑:rootadmin
微信小程序最新获取头像和昵称的方法 直接用! 调整背景

推荐整理分享微信小程序最新获取头像和昵称的方法 直接用!(微信小程序最新咸鱼之王兑换),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:微信小程序最新咸鱼之王兑换,微信小程序最新小游戏,微信小程序最新获取用户信息,微信小程序最新版本,微信小程序最新黑科技,微信小程序最新动怿,微信小程序最新黑科技,微信小程序最新游戏,内容如对您有帮助,希望把文章链接给更多的朋友!

微信小程序获取用户头像和昵称一个开放接口是wx.getUserInfo,2021年4月5日被废弃,原因是很多开发者在打开小程序时就通过组件方式唤起getUserInfo弹窗,如果用户点击拒绝,无法使用小程序,这种做法打断了用户正常使用小程序的流程,同时也不利于小程序获取新用户,后面新添加的一个开放接口wx.getUserProfile,也是用于获取用户头像和昵称

微信小程序最新获取头像和昵称的方法 直接用!(微信小程序最新咸鱼之王兑换)

关于wx.getUserProfile

但2022 年 10 月 25 日 24 时后(以下统称 “生效期” ),用户头像昵称获取规则将进行如下调整

考虑到微信版本的更新,目前开发最好还是使用头像昵称填写能力这个方法来做,废话不多说代码奉上头像填写

从基础库 2.21.2 开始支持

当小程序需要让用户完善个人资料时,可以通过微信提供的头像昵称填写能力快速完善。

根据相关法律法规,为确保信息安全,由用户上传的图片、昵称等信息微信侧将进行安全检测,组件从基础库2.24.4版本起,已接入内容安全服务端接口(mediaCheckAsync、msgSecCheck),以减少内容安全风险对开发者的影响。

昵称填写

代码示例<view data-weui-theme="{{theme}}"><button class="avatar-wrapper" open-type="chooseAvatar" bindchooseavatar="onChooseAvatar"><image class="avatar" src="{{avatarUrl}}"></image></button><form catchsubmit="formSubmit"><view class="row"><view class="text1">昵称:</view><input type="nickname" class="weui-input" name="nickname" placeholder="请输入昵称"/></view><button type="primary" style="margin-top: 40rpx;margin-bottom: 20rpx;" form-type="submit">提交</button></form></view>.avatar-wrapper {padding: 0;width: 56px !important;border-radius: 8px;margin-top: 40px;margin-bottom: 40px;background-color: #fff;}.avatar {display: block;width: 56px;height: 56px;}.container {display: flex;}.row{border-top: 1px solid #ccc;border-bottom: 1px solid #ccc;display: flex;align-items: center;height: 80rpx;padding-left: 20rpx;}.text1{flex: 2;}.weui-input{flex: 6;}const app = getApp()const defaultAvatarUrl = 'https://mmbiz.qpic.cn/mmbiz/icTdbqWNOwNRna42FI242Lcia07jQodd2FJGIYQfG0LAJGFxM4FbnQP6yfMxBgJ0F3YRqJCJ1aPAK2dQagdusBZg/0'Page({/*** 页面的初始数据*/data: {avatarUrl: defaultAvatarUrl,theme: wx.getSystemInfoSync().theme,},onChooseAvatar(e) {const { avatarUrl } = e.detailthis.setData({avatarUrl,})app.globalData.userInfo.avatarUrl = avatarUrl},formSubmit(e){app.globalData.userInfo.nickName = e.detail.value.nicknamewx.switchTab({url: '/pages/home/index',})},/*** 生命周期函数--监听页面加载*/onLoad(options) {wx.onThemeChange((result) => {this.setData({theme: result.theme})})},
本文链接地址:https://www.jiuchutong.com/zhishi/297596.html 转载请保留说明!

上一篇:Transformer框架时间序列模型Informer内容与代码解读(transform模块)

下一篇:Vue配置文件中的proxy配置(vue3配置文件)

  • 个体户年报纳税额怎么填
  • 对公付款对方不开发票怎么处理
  • 滴滴行程单修改器
  • 给员工发开门红包的通知
  • 公司购车预计净残值率怎么计算
  • 小规模纳税人支付的增值税
  • 业务人员差旅费为什么不计入投资性房地产成本
  • 如何规范填写费用表格
  • 收回多缴税金会计分录
  • 子女教育专项附加扣除是什么意思
  • 活动现金红包
  • 非货币交易例子
  • 无票销售纳税后怎么处理
  • 增值税可以抵扣企业所得税吗
  • 企业租车费用怎么处理方法
  • 免税销售额收入不含税收入怎么算
  • 单位缴交的社保和医保还要交其他费用吗
  • 押金拿不到怎么解决
  • 固定资产处置要交所得税吗
  • 消防费用怎么做分录
  • 员工加班车费会计分录
  • 电子钥匙续费应用在哪里
  • ubuntu20.04安装make
  • 男人喜欢什么样的女人最容易动心
  • 企业生产经营管理费用包括
  • vite报错
  • 境外汇款预处理是什么意思
  • php静态属性和静态方法
  • 关于商业承兑汇票的多选题有哪些
  • 即征即退先征后返属于政府补助吗
  • 三代手续费返还计入什么科目
  • 火车票抵税申报表怎么填
  • 研发费用如何做加计扣除
  • 认证发票可以分两次进行吗
  • 帝国cms如何使用
  • 职工福利费的开支范围的规定扣除
  • 权益法核算还计提减值么
  • 汽车租赁费怎么做分录
  • 增值税怎么开
  • 公司买车可以少多少钱
  • 已开票未收款怎么报税
  • 公户转私户的钱怎么退回来
  • 工程材料增值税抵扣比例
  • 个税公司少申报一个月会对个人有什么影响
  • 业务招待费可以结转下年抵扣吗
  • 收履约保证金的会计分录
  • 收到投资厂房有折旧的记账凭证怎么处理
  • 投资性房地产摊销从什么时候开始
  • 旅行社代订机票怎么做账
  • windows进程数
  • 电脑ahci模式什么意思
  • centos bz
  • windows7计算机管理拒绝访问
  • win8系统怎么改win10
  • win10预览在哪里
  • Red Hat Enterprise Linux 5.X的图形安装教程
  • final cut pro能破解吗
  • linux关闭sh
  • 服务器centos7
  • win8打开蓝牙设置
  • 没有启动界面
  • win8系统笔记本怎么恢复出厂设置
  • 给网页添加javascript
  • nodejs中的模块以及作用
  • css网站布局实录 pdf
  • python计算两个数的最大公约数
  • perl-v
  • javascript中的函数也称为什么
  • css div 不换行
  • 怎么把两个文件中的内容合并
  • unity与android交互详细
  • 简单介绍一下自己
  • unity性能和内存优化
  • javascript的dom
  • python设计教程
  • js实现全屏
  • 甘肃省政府非税收入电子发票在哪里打印
  • 个人出租商铺个人所得税计算
  • 电子发票美元如何查询
  • 浙江省焊工操作证查询
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设